Issue # (if applicable)
Closes #34811
Related: aws-cloudformation/cloudformation-coverage-roadmap#1101
Reason for this change
Support for tag propagation to underlying resources (Lambda) for AWS Synthetics.
Description of changes
Add support for
ResourcesToReplicateTags
property (like CF)Describe any new or updated permissions being added
